CVE-2026-41488 (GCVE-0-2026-41488)

Vulnerability from cvelistv5 – Published: 2026-04-24 20:57 – Updated: 2026-04-24 20:57
VLAI?
Title
angchain-openai: Image token counting SSRF protection can be bypassed via DNS rebinding
Summary
LangChain is a framework for building agents and LLM-powered applications. Prior to 1.1.14, langchain-openai's _url_to_size() helper (used by get_num_tokens_from_messages for image token counting) validated URLs for SSRF protection and then fetched them in a separate network operation with independent DNS resolution. This left a TOCTOU / DNS rebinding window: an attacker-controlled hostname could resolve to a public IP during validation and then to a private/localhost IP during the actual fetch.
CWE
  • CWE-918 - Server-Side Request Forgery (SSRF)

CVE-2026-41481 (GCVE-0-2026-41481)

Vulnerability from cvelistv5 – Published: 2026-04-24 20:54 – Updated: 2026-04-25 01:54
VLAI?
Title
LangChain: HTMLHeaderTextSplitter.split_text_from_url SSRF Redirect Bypass
Summary
LangChain is a framework for building agents and LLM-powered applications. Prior to langchain-text-splitters 1.1.2, HTMLHeaderTextSplitter.split_text_from_url() validated the initial URL using validate_safe_url() but then performed the fetch with requests.get() with redirects enabled (the default). Because redirect targets were not revalidated, a URL pointing to an attacker-controlled server could redirect to internal, localhost, or cloud metadata endpoints, bypassing SSRF protections. The response body is parsed and returned as Document objects to the calling application code. Whether this constitutes a data exfiltration path depends on the application: if it exposes Document contents (or derivatives) back to the requester who supplied the URL, sensitive data from internal endpoints could be leaked. Applications that store or process Documents internally without returning raw content to the requester are not directly exposed to data exfiltration through this issue. This vulnerability is fixed in 1.1.2.
CWE
  • CWE-918 - Server-Side Request Forgery (SSRF)

CVE-2026-41182 (GCVE-0-2026-41182)

Vulnerability from cvelistv5 – Published: 2026-04-23 00:14 – Updated: 2026-04-23 16:23
VLAI?
Title
LangSmith SDK: Streaming token events bypass output redaction
Summary
LangSmith Client SDKs provide SDK's for interacting with the LangSmith platform. Prior to version 0.5.19 of the JavaScript SDK and version 0.7.31 of the Python SDK, the LangSmith SDK's output redaction controls (hideOutputs in JS, hide_outputs in Python) do not apply to streaming token events. When an LLM run produces streaming output, each chunk is recorded as a new_token event containing the raw token value. These events bypass the redaction pipeline entirely — prepareRunCreateOrUpdateInputs (JS) and _hide_run_outputs (Python) only process the inputs and outputs fields on a run, never the events array. As a result, applications relying on output redaction to prevent sensitive LLM output from being stored in LangSmith will still leak the full streamed content via run events. Version 0.5.19 of the JavaScript SDK and version 0.7.31 of the Python SDK fix the issue.
CWE
  • CWE-200 - Exposure of Sensitive Information to an Unauthorized Actor
  • CWE-359 - Exposure of Private Personal Information to an Unauthorized Actor
  • CWE-532 - Insertion of Sensitive Information into Log File

CVE-2026-40190 (GCVE-0-2026-40190)

Vulnerability from cvelistv5 – Published: 2026-04-10 19:47 – Updated: 2026-04-13 16:13
VLAI?
Title
LangSmith Client SDKs has Prototype Pollution in langsmith-sdk via Incomplete `__proto__` Guard in Internal lodash `set()`
Summary
LangSmith Client SDKs provide SDK's for interacting with the LangSmith platform. Prior to 0.5.18, the LangSmith JavaScript/TypeScript SDK (langsmith) contains an incomplete prototype pollution fix in its internally vendored lodash set() utility. The baseAssignValue() function only guards against the __proto__ key, but fails to prevent traversal via constructor.prototype. This allows an attacker who controls keys in data processed by the createAnonymizer() API to pollute Object.prototype, affecting all objects in the Node.js process. This vulnerability is fixed in 0.5.18.
CWE
  • CWE-1321 - Improperly Controlled Modification of Object Prototype Attributes ('Prototype Pollution')

CVE-2026-40087 (GCVE-0-2026-40087)

Vulnerability from cvelistv5 – Published: 2026-04-09 19:34 – Updated: 2026-04-14 14:48
VLAI?
Title
LangChain has incomplete f-string validation in prompt templates
Summary
LangChain is a framework for building agents and LLM-powered applications. Prior to 0.3.84 and 1.2.28, LangChain's f-string prompt-template validation was incomplete in two respects. First, some prompt template classes accepted f-string templates and formatted them without enforcing the same attribute-access validation as PromptTemplate. In particular, DictPromptTemplate and ImagePromptTemplate could accept templates containing attribute access or indexing expressions and subsequently evaluate those expressions during formatting. Second, f-string validation based on parsed top-level field names did not reject nested replacement fields inside format specifiers. In this pattern, the nested replacement field appears in the format specifier rather than in the top-level field name. As a result, earlier validation based on parsed field names did not reject the template even though Python formatting would still attempt to resolve the nested expression at runtime. This vulnerability is fixed in 0.3.84 and 1.2.28.
CWE
  • CWE-1336 - Improper Neutralization of Special Elements Used in a Template Engine

CVE-2026-34070 (GCVE-0-2026-34070)

Vulnerability from cvelistv5 – Published: 2026-03-31 02:01 – Updated: 2026-03-31 18:04
VLAI?
Title
LangChain Core has Path Traversal vulnerabilites in legacy `load_prompt` functions
Summary
LangChain is a framework for building agents and LLM-powered applications. Prior to version 1.2.22, multiple functions in langchain_core.prompts.loading read files from paths embedded in deserialized config dicts without validating against directory traversal or absolute path injection. When an application passes user-influenced prompt configurations to load_prompt() or load_prompt_from_config(), an attacker can read arbitrary files on the host filesystem, constrained only by file-extension checks (.txt for templates, .json/.yaml for examples). This issue has been patched in version 1.2.22.
CWE
  • CWE-22 - Improper Limitation of a Pathname to a Restricted Directory ('Path Traversal')

CVE-2026-28277 (GCVE-0-2026-28277)

Vulnerability from cvelistv5 – Published: 2026-03-05 19:10 – Updated: 2026-03-06 18:04
VLAI?
Title
LangGraph: Unsafe msgpack deserialization in LangGraph checkpoint loading
Summary
LangGraph SQLite Checkpoint is an implementation of LangGraph CheckpointSaver that uses SQLite DB (both sync and async, via aiosqlite). In version 1.0.9 and prior, LangGraph checkpointers can load msgpack-encoded checkpoints that reconstruct Python objects during deserialization. If an attacker can modify checkpoint data in the backing store (for example, after a database compromise or other privileged write access to the persistence layer), they can potentially supply a crafted payload that triggers unsafe object reconstruction when the checkpoint is loaded. No known patch is public.
CWE
  • CWE-502 - Deserialization of Untrusted Data

CVE-2026-25750 (GCVE-0-2026-25750)

Vulnerability from cvelistv5 – Published: 2026-03-04 21:58 – Updated: 2026-03-05 15:42
VLAI?
Title
LangSmith Studio has URL Parameter Injection Vulnerability that Enables Token Theft via Malicious baseUrl
Summary
Langchain Helm Charts are Helm charts for deploying Langchain applications on Kubernetes. Prior to langchain-ai/helm version 0.12.71, a URL parameter injection vulnerability existed in LangSmith Studio that could allow unauthorized access to user accounts through stolen authentication tokens. The vulnerability affected both LangSmith Cloud and self-hosted deployments. Authenticated LangSmith users who clicked on a specially crafted malicious link would have their bearer token, user ID, and workspace ID transmitted to an attacker-controlled server. With this stolen token, an attacker could impersonate the victim and access any LangSmith resources or perform any actions the user was authorized to perform within their workspace. The attack required social engineering (phishing, malicious links in emails or chat applications) to convince users to click the crafted URL. The stolen tokens expired after 5 minutes, though repeated attacks against the same user were possible if they could be convinced to click malicious links multiple times. The fix in version 0.12.71 implements validation requiring user-defined allowed origins for the baseUrl parameter, preventing tokens from being sent to unauthorized servers. No known workarounds are available. Self-hosted customers must upgrade to the patched version.
CWE
  • CWE-74 - Improper Neutralization of Special Elements in Output Used by a Downstream Component ('Injection')

CVE-2026-27795 (GCVE-0-2026-27795)

Vulnerability from cvelistv5 – Published: 2026-02-25 17:30 – Updated: 2026-02-25 18:42
VLAI?
Title
LangChain Community: redirect chaining can lead to SSRF bypass via RecursiveUrlLoader
Summary
LangChain is a framework for building LLM-powered applications. Prior to version 1.1.8, a redirect-based Server-Side Request Forgery (SSRF) bypass exists in `RecursiveUrlLoader` in `@langchain/community`. The loader validates the initial URL but allows the underlying fetch to follow redirects automatically, which permits a transition from a safe public URL to an internal or metadata endpoint without revalidation. This is a bypass of the SSRF protections introduced in 1.1.14 (CVE-2026-26019). Users should upgrade to `@langchain/community` 1.1.18, which validates every redirect hop by disabling automatic redirects and re-validating `Location` targets before following them. In this version, automatic redirects are disabled (`redirect: "manual"`), each 3xx `Location` is resolved and validated with `validateSafeUrl()` before the next request, and a maximum redirect limit prevents infinite loops.
CWE
  • CWE-918 - Server-Side Request Forgery (SSRF)

CVE-2026-27794 (GCVE-0-2026-27794)

Vulnerability from cvelistv5 – Published: 2026-02-25 16:53 – Updated: 2026-02-25 21:00
VLAI?
Title
LangGraph: BaseCache Deserialization of Untrusted Data may lead to Remote Code Execution
Summary
LangGraph Checkpoint defines the base interface for LangGraph checkpointers. Prior to version 4.0.0, a Remote Code Execution vulnerability exists in LangGraph's caching layer when applications enable cache backends that inherit from `BaseCache` and opt nodes into caching via `CachePolicy`. Prior to `langgraph-checkpoint` 4.0.0, `BaseCache` defaults to `JsonPlusSerializer(pickle_fallback=True)`. When msgpack serialization fails, cached values can be deserialized via `pickle.loads(...)`. Caching is not enabled by default. Applications are affected only when the application explicitly enables a cache backend (for example by passing `cache=...` to `StateGraph.compile(...)` or otherwise configuring a `BaseCache` implementation), one or more nodes opt into caching via `CachePolicy`, and the attacker can write to the cache backend (for example a network-accessible Redis instance with weak/no auth, shared cache infrastructure reachable by other tenants/services, or a writable SQLite cache file). An attacker must be able to write attacker-controlled bytes into the cache backend such that the LangGraph process later reads and deserializes them. This typically requires write access to a networked cache (for example a network-accessible Redis instance with weak/no auth or shared cache infrastructure reachable by other tenants/services) or write access to local cache storage (for example a writable SQLite cache file via permissive file permissions or a shared writable volume). Because exploitation requires write access to the cache storage layer, this is a post-compromise / post-access escalation vector. LangGraph Checkpoint 4.0.0 patches the issue.
CWE
  • CWE-502 - Deserialization of Untrusted Data

CVE-2026-27022 (GCVE-0-2026-27022)

Vulnerability from cvelistv5 – Published: 2026-02-20 21:06 – Updated: 2026-02-24 18:33
VLAI?
Title
RediSearch Query Injection in @langchain/langgraph-checkpoint-redis
Summary
@langchain/langgraph-checkpoint-redis is the Redis checkpoint and store implementation for LangGraph. A query injection vulnerability exists in the @langchain/langgraph-checkpoint-redis package's filter handling. The RedisSaver and ShallowRedisSaver classes construct RediSearch queries by directly interpolating user-provided filter keys and values without proper escaping. RediSearch has special syntax characters that can modify query behavior, and when user-controlled data contains these characters, the query logic can be manipulated to bypass intended access controls. This vulnerability is fixed in 1.0.2.
CWE
  • CWE-74 - Improper Neutralization of Special Elements in Output Used by a Downstream Component ('Injection')

CVE-2026-26019 (GCVE-0-2026-26019)

Vulnerability from cvelistv5 – Published: 2026-02-11 21:11 – Updated: 2026-02-12 21:14
VLAI?
Title
@langchain/community affected by SSRF Bypass in RecursiveUrlLoader via insufficient URL origin validation
Summary
LangChain is a framework for building LLM-powered applications. Prior to 1.1.14, the RecursiveUrlLoader class in @langchain/community is a web crawler that recursively follows links from a starting URL. Its preventOutside option (enabled by default) is intended to restrict crawling to the same site as the base URL. The implementation used String.startsWith() to compare URLs, which does not perform semantic URL validation. An attacker who controls content on a crawled page could include links to domains that share a string prefix with the target, causing the crawler to follow links to attacker-controlled or internal infrastructure. Additionally, the crawler performed no validation against private or reserved IP addresses. A crawled page could include links targeting cloud metadata services, localhost, or RFC 1918 addresses, and the crawler would fetch them without restriction. This vulnerability is fixed in 1.1.14.
CWE
  • CWE-918 - Server-Side Request Forgery (SSRF)

CVE-2026-26013 (GCVE-0-2026-26013)

Vulnerability from cvelistv5 – Published: 2026-02-10 21:51 – Updated: 2026-02-11 21:26
VLAI?
Title
LangChain affected by SSRF via image_url token counting in ChatOpenAI.get_num_tokens_from_messages
Summary
LangChain is a framework for building agents and LLM-powered applications. Prior to 1.2.11, the ChatOpenAI.get_num_tokens_from_messages() method fetches arbitrary image_url values without validation when computing token counts for vision-enabled models. This allows attackers to trigger Server-Side Request Forgery (SSRF) attacks by providing malicious image URLs in user input. This vulnerability is fixed in 1.2.11.
CWE
  • CWE-918 - Server-Side Request Forgery (SSRF)

CVE-2026-25528 (GCVE-0-2026-25528)

Vulnerability from cvelistv5 – Published: 2026-02-09 20:08 – Updated: 2026-02-10 15:59
VLAI?
Title
LangSmith Client SDK Affected by Server-Side Request Forgery via Tracing Header Injection
Summary
LangSmith Client SDKs provide SDK's for interacting with the LangSmith platform. The LangSmith SDK's distributed tracing feature is vulnerable to Server-Side Request Forgery via malicious HTTP headers. An attacker can inject arbitrary api_url values through the baggage header, causing the SDK to exfiltrate sensitive trace data to attacker-controlled endpoints. When using distributed tracing, the SDK parses incoming HTTP headers via RunTree.from_headers() in Python or RunTree.fromHeaders() in Typescript. The baggage header can contain replica configurations including api_url and api_key fields. Prior to the fix, these attacker-controlled values were accepted without validation. When a traced operation completes, the SDK's post() and patch() methods send run data to all configured replica URLs, including any injected by an attacker. This vulnerability is fixed in version 0.6.3 of the Python SDK and 0.4.6 of the JavaScript SDK.
CWE
  • CWE-918 - Server-Side Request Forgery (SSRF)

CVE-2025-68665 (GCVE-0-2025-68665)

Vulnerability from cvelistv5 – Published: 2025-12-23 22:56 – Updated: 2025-12-24 14:38
VLAI?
Title
LangChain serialization injection vulnerability enables secret extraction
Summary
LangChain is a framework for building LLM-powered applications. Prior to @langchain/core versions 0.3.80 and 1.1.8, and prior to langchain versions 0.3.37 and 1.2.3, a serialization injection vulnerability exists in LangChain JS's toJSON() method (and subsequently when string-ifying objects using JSON.stringify(). The method did not escape objects with 'lc' keys when serializing free-form data in kwargs. The 'lc' key is used internally by LangChain to mark serialized objects. When user-controlled data contains this key structure, it is treated as a legitimate LangChain object during deserialization rather than plain user data. This issue has been patched in @langchain/core versions 0.3.80 and 1.1.8, and langchain versions 0.3.37 and 1.2.3
CWE
  • CWE-502 - Deserialization of Untrusted Data

CVE-2025-68664 (GCVE-0-2025-68664)

Vulnerability from cvelistv5 – Published: 2025-12-23 22:47 – Updated: 2025-12-24 14:40
VLAI?
Title
LangChain serialization injection vulnerability enables secret extraction in dumps/loads APIs
Summary
LangChain is a framework for building agents and LLM-powered applications. Prior to versions 0.3.81 and 1.2.5, a serialization injection vulnerability exists in LangChain's dumps() and dumpd() functions. The functions do not escape dictionaries with 'lc' keys when serializing free-form dictionaries. The 'lc' key is used internally by LangChain to mark serialized objects. When user-controlled data contains this key structure, it is treated as a legitimate LangChain object during deserialization rather than plain user data. This issue has been patched in versions 0.3.81 and 1.2.5.
CWE
  • CWE-502 - Deserialization of Untrusted Data

CVE-2025-67644 (GCVE-0-2025-67644)

Vulnerability from cvelistv5 – Published: 2025-12-10 23:37 – Updated: 2025-12-11 15:35
VLAI?
Title
LangGraph SQLite Checkpoint is vulnerable to SQL Injection via metadata filter key in checkpointer list method
Summary
LangGraph SQLite Checkpoint is an implementation of LangGraph CheckpointSaver that uses SQLite DB (both sync and async, via aiosqlite). Versions 3.0.0 and below are vulnerable to SQL injection through the checkpoint implementation. Checkpoint allows attackers to manipulate SQL queries through metadata filter keys, affecting applications that accept untrusted metadata filter keys (not just filter values) in checkpoint search operations. The _metadata_predicate() function constructs SQL queries by interpolating filter keys directly into f-strings without validation. This issue is fixed in version 3.0.1.
CWE
  • CWE-89 - Improper Neutralization of Special Elements used in an SQL Command ('SQL Injection')

CVE-2025-65106 (GCVE-0-2025-65106)

Vulnerability from cvelistv5 – Published: 2025-11-21 21:43 – Updated: 2025-11-21 21:53
VLAI?
Title
LangChain Vulnerable to Template Injection via Attribute Access in Prompt Templates
Summary
LangChain is a framework for building agents and LLM-powered applications. From versions 0.3.79 and prior and 1.0.0 to 1.0.6, a template injection vulnerability exists in LangChain's prompt template system that allows attackers to access Python object internals through template syntax. This vulnerability affects applications that accept untrusted template strings (not just template variables) in ChatPromptTemplate and related prompt template classes. This issue has been patched in versions 0.3.80 and 1.0.7.
CWE
  • CWE-1336 - Improper Neutralization of Special Elements Used in a Template Engine

CVE-2025-64439 (GCVE-0-2025-64439)

Vulnerability from cvelistv5 – Published: 2025-11-07 20:15 – Updated: 2025-11-07 20:21
VLAI?
Title
LangGraph Checkpoint affected by RCE in "json" mode of JsonPlusSerializer
Summary
LangGraph SQLite Checkpoint is an implementation of LangGraph CheckpointSaver that uses SQLite DB (both sync and async, via aiosqlite). In versions 2.1.2 and below, the JsonPlusSerializer (used as the default serialization protocol for all checkpointing) contains a Remote Code Execution (RCE) vulnerability when deserializing payloads saved in the "json" serialization mode. By default, the serializer attempts to use "msgpack" for serialization. However, prior to version 3.0 of the checkpointer library, if illegal Unicode surrogate values caused serialization to fail, it would fall back to using the "json" mode. This issue is fixed in version 3.0.0.
CWE
  • CWE-502 - Deserialization of Untrusted Data

CVE-2025-64104 (GCVE-0-2025-64104)

Vulnerability from cvelistv5 – Published: 2025-10-29 18:55 – Updated: 2025-10-30 15:33
VLAI?
Title
LangGraph SQLite Checkpoint Filter Key SQL Injection POC for SqliteStore
Summary
LangGraph SQLite Checkpoint is an implementation of LangGraph CheckpointSaver that uses SQLite DB (both sync and async, via aiosqlite). Prior to 2.0.11, LangGraph's SQLite store implementation contains SQL injection vulnerabilities using direct string concatenation without proper parameterization, allowing attackers to inject arbitrary SQL and bypass access controls. This vulnerability is fixed in 2.0.11.
CWE
  • CWE-89 - Improper Neutralization of Special Elements used in an SQL Command ('SQL Injection')

CVE-2025-8709 (GCVE-0-2025-8709)

Vulnerability from cvelistv5 – Published: 2025-10-26 05:38 – Updated: 2025-10-28 14:32
VLAI?
Title
SQL Injection in langchain-ai/langchain
Summary
A SQL injection vulnerability exists in the langchain-ai/langchain repository, specifically in the LangGraph's SQLite store implementation. The affected version is langgraph-checkpoint-sqlite 2.0.10. The vulnerability arises from improper handling of filter operators ($eq, $ne, $gt, $lt, $gte, $lte) where direct string concatenation is used without proper parameterization. This allows attackers to inject arbitrary SQL, leading to unauthorized access to all documents, data exfiltration of sensitive fields such as passwords and API keys, and a complete bypass of application-level security filters.
CWE
  • CWE-89 - Improper Neutralization of Special Elements used in an SQL Command

CVE-2025-6985 (GCVE-0-2025-6985)

Vulnerability from cvelistv5 – Published: 2025-10-06 17:58 – Updated: 2025-10-06 18:10
VLAI?
Title
XXE Vulnerability in langchain-ai/langchain
Summary
The HTMLSectionSplitter class in langchain-text-splitters version 0.3.8 is vulnerable to XML External Entity (XXE) attacks due to unsafe XSLT parsing. This vulnerability arises because the class allows the use of arbitrary XSLT stylesheets, which are parsed using lxml.etree.parse() and lxml.etree.XSLT() without any hardening measures. In lxml versions up to 4.9.x, external entities are resolved by default, allowing attackers to read arbitrary local files or perform outbound HTTP(S) fetches. In lxml versions 5.0 and above, while entity expansion is disabled, the XSLT document() function can still read any URI unless XSLTAccessControl is applied. This vulnerability allows remote attackers to gain read-only access to any file the LangChain process can reach, including sensitive files such as SSH keys, environment files, source code, or cloud metadata. No authentication, special privileges, or user interaction are required, and the issue is exploitable in default deployments that enable custom XSLT.
CWE
  • CWE-611 - Improper Restriction of XML External Entity Reference

CVE-2025-6984 (GCVE-0-2025-6984)

Vulnerability from cvelistv5 – Published: 2025-09-04 08:07 – Updated: 2025-09-04 20:07
VLAI?
Title
Sensitive Information Disclosure Due to Insecure XML Parsing in langchain-ai/langchain
Summary
The langchain-ai/langchain project, specifically the EverNoteLoader component, is vulnerable to XML External Entity (XXE) attacks due to insecure XML parsing. The affected version is 0.3.63. The vulnerability arises from the use of etree.iterparse() without disabling external entity references, which can lead to sensitive information disclosure. An attacker could exploit this by crafting a malicious XML payload that references local files, potentially exposing sensitive data such as /etc/passwd.
CWE
  • CWE-200 - Exposure of Sensitive Information to an Unauthorized Actor

CVE-2025-2828 (GCVE-0-2025-2828)

Vulnerability from cvelistv5 – Published: 2025-06-23 20:42 – Updated: 2025-06-24 13:32
VLAI?
Title
SSRF Vulnerability in RequestsToolkit in langchain-ai/langchain
Summary
A Server-Side Request Forgery (SSRF) vulnerability exists in the RequestsToolkit component of the langchain-community package (specifically, langchain_community.agent_toolkits.openapi.toolkit.RequestsToolkit) in langchain-ai/langchain version 0.0.27. This vulnerability occurs because the toolkit does not enforce restrictions on requests to remote internet addresses, allowing it to also access local addresses. As a result, an attacker could exploit this flaw to perform port scans, access local services, retrieve instance metadata from cloud environments (e.g., Azure, AWS), and interact with servers on the local network. This issue has been fixed in version 0.0.28.
CWE
  • CWE-918 - Server-Side Request Forgery (SSRF)

CVE-2024-10940 (GCVE-0-2024-10940)

Vulnerability from cvelistv5 – Published: 2025-03-20 10:08 – Updated: 2025-03-20 19:02
VLAI?
Title
Exposure of Sensitive System Information via ImagePromptTemplate in langchain-ai/langchain
Summary
A vulnerability in langchain-core versions >=0.1.17,<0.1.53, >=0.2.0,<0.2.43, and >=0.3.0,<0.3.15 allows unauthorized users to read arbitrary files from the host file system. The issue arises from the ability to create langchain_core.prompts.ImagePromptTemplate's (and by extension langchain_core.prompts.ChatPromptTemplate's) with input variables that can read any user-specified path from the server file system. If the outputs of these prompt templates are exposed to the user, either directly or through downstream model outputs, it can lead to the exposure of sensitive information.
CWE
  • CWE-497 - Exposure of Sensitive System Information to an Unauthorized Control Sphere

CVE-2024-8309 (GCVE-0-2024-8309)

Vulnerability from cvelistv5 – Published: 2024-10-29 12:50 – Updated: 2025-10-15 12:50
VLAI?
Title
SQL Injection in langchain-ai/langchain
Summary
A vulnerability in the GraphCypherQAChain class of langchain-ai/langchain version 0.2.5 allows for SQL injection through prompt injection. This vulnerability can lead to unauthorized data manipulation, data exfiltration, denial of service (DoS) by deleting all data, breaches in multi-tenant security environments, and data integrity issues. Attackers can create, update, or delete nodes and relationships without proper authorization, extract sensitive data, disrupt services, access data across different tenants, and compromise the integrity of the database.
CWE
  • CWE-89 - Improper Neutralization of Special Elements used in an SQL Command

CVE-2024-7774 (GCVE-0-2024-7774)

Vulnerability from cvelistv5 – Published: 2024-10-29 12:49 – Updated: 2024-10-29 13:31
VLAI?
Title
Path Traversal in langchain-ai/langchainjs
Summary
A path traversal vulnerability exists in the `getFullPath` method of langchain-ai/langchainjs version 0.2.5. This vulnerability allows attackers to save files anywhere in the filesystem, overwrite existing text files, read `.txt` files, and delete files. The vulnerability is exploited through the `setFileContent`, `getParsedFile`, and `mdelete` methods, which do not properly sanitize user input.
CWE
  • CWE-29 - Path Traversal: '\..\filename'

CVE-2024-5998 (GCVE-0-2024-5998)

Vulnerability from cvelistv5 – Published: 2024-09-17 11:50 – Updated: 2024-09-17 13:34
VLAI?
Title
Deserialization of Untrusted Data in langchain-ai/langchain
Summary
A vulnerability in the FAISS.deserialize_from_bytes function of langchain-ai/langchain allows for pickle deserialization of untrusted data. This can lead to the execution of arbitrary commands via the os.system function. The issue affects the latest version of the product.
CWE
  • CWE-502 - Deserialization of Untrusted Data

CVE-2024-2965 (GCVE-0-2024-2965)

Vulnerability from cvelistv5 – Published: 2024-06-06 18:52 – Updated: 2025-10-15 12:50
VLAI?
Title
Denial-of-Service in LangChain SitemapLoader in langchain-ai/langchain
Summary
A Denial-of-Service (DoS) vulnerability exists in the `SitemapLoader` class of the `langchain-ai/langchain` repository, affecting all versions. The `parse_sitemap` method, responsible for parsing sitemaps and extracting URLs, lacks a mechanism to prevent infinite recursion when a sitemap URL refers to the current sitemap itself. This oversight allows for the possibility of an infinite loop, leading to a crash by exceeding the maximum recursion depth in Python. This vulnerability can be exploited to occupy server socket/port resources and crash the Python process, impacting the availability of services relying on this functionality.
